  8. They dont "bolt right in". You will need two left Z31 shafts and one right Z31 shaft, or was it two right Z31 shafts and one left? :stupid: Anyhow you need 3 of them and there is some cutting an welding to get the length right. http://www.speed-technology.com have done a few in their time.

  16. Wrapping is to reduce heat radiation. The most success I have had with noise reduction on a sports exhaust is to use centre offset mufflers. These are still straight through and flow well, but the entry is in the centre of the oval casing and the exit is offset to one side (or vice versa) meaning the muffler had greater internal surface area to absorb noise. Playing with resonators did nothing for me when I was trying to pass an EPA test.
